运维

运维

Products

当前位置:首页 > 运维 >

如何用ifconfig命令查看网络状态?

96SEO 2025-04-26 12:32 1



Linux系统网络略策化优与理管态状口接口状态管理与优化策略

Linux系统的稳定性和性能对业务连续性和数据安全至关重要。网络接口状态的管理与优化是确保系统高效运行的关键环节。本文将从多个维度深入剖析Linux系统中网络接口状态管理的具体问题,并提出相应的优化策略。

一、网络接口状态管理的背景及问题

Linux系统中的网络接口状态管理涉及对IP地址、子网掩码、MAC地址等信息的配置与监控。不当的网络配置可能导致网络连接不稳定、数据传输速率降低等问题,从而影响系统性能和业务运营。

ifconfig命令如何查看网络状态

在特定环境下,网络接口状态管理的问题可能包括:

  • IP地址冲突多个网络接口配置了相同的IP地址,导致网络通信失败。
  • 子网掩码设置错误子网掩码配置不当,可能使网络设备无法正确识别网络范围。
  • MAC地址伪造MAC地址伪造可能导致网络攻击和数据泄露。

这些问题若不及时解决,将严重影响系统性能和业务连续性。

二、网络接口状态优化策略

针对上述问题,

1. 使用ifconfig命令查看网络接口状态

ifconfig命令是Linux系统中常用的网络配置和监控工具。通过运行ifconfig命令,可以查看系统中所有网络接口的状态,包括IP地址、子网掩码、MAC地址等。

  • 工作原理ifconfig命令通过读取Linux内核中的网络设备信息,将网络接口的状态展示给用户。
  • 实际案例在ifconfig命令输出中,可以观察到网络接口的MTU、接收和发送数据包统计等信息。
  • 实施建议定期使用ifconfig命令查看网络接口状态,及时发现并解决潜在问题。

2. 使用ip命令替代ifconfig

由于ifconfig命令在某些Linux发行版中已被弃用,建议使用ip命令替代。

  • 工作原理ip命令提供了与ifconfig类似的功能,但更加现代和强大。
  • 实际案例使用ip addr命令可以查看系统中所有网络接口的详细信息。
  • 实施建议在Linux发行版中,优先使用ip命令进行网络接口状态管理和配置。

3. 使用route命令配置路由表

route命令用于配置Linux系统中的路由表,确保数据包能够正确到达目标地址。

  • 工作原理route命令通过添加或删除路由规则,实现数据包在不同网络接口之间的转发。
  • 实际案例使用route add命令可以添加新的路由规则,例如将特定IP地址的数据包转发到指定接口。
  • 实施建议定期检查路由表配置,确保路由规则正确无误。

4. 使用net-tools工具包

net-tools工具包包含一系列网络管理工具,如ifconfig、ping、traceroute等。

  • 工作原理net-tools工具包提供了一套完整的网络管理工具,方便用户进行网络配置和监控。
  • 实际案例使用net-tools工具包中的工具,可以轻松查看网络接口状态、测试网络连通性等。
  • 实施建议安装net-tools工具包,以便在需要时使用相关工具。

通过对Linux系统中网络接口状态管理进行优化,可以有效提高系统性能和业务连续性。本文介绍了ifconfig、ip、route等命令的使用方法,并提供了实际案例和数据支撑。在实际操作中,请根据具体业务场景选择合适的优化策略,并建立持续的性能监控体系,确保系统始终保持最优状态。

标签: Linux

提交需求或反馈

Demand feedback